Acute dronedarone is inferior to amiodarone in terminating and preventing atrial fibrillation in canine atria

BackgroundDronedarone is approved by the U.S. Food and Drug Administration for the treatment of patients with atrial fibrillation (AF) as a safe alternative to amiodarone. There are no full-length published reports describing the effectiveness of acute dronedarone use against AF in experimental or clinical studies.ObjectiveThe purpose of this study was to determine the effect of acute dronedarone and amiodarone on electrophysiological parameters, and their anti-AF efficacy in canine isolated arterially perfused right atria.MethodsTransmembrane action potentials and pseudoelectrocardiograms were recorded. Acetylcholine (ACh, 1.0 μM) was used to induce persistent AF.ResultsAmiodarone-induced changes were much more pronounced than those of dronedarone on (1) action potential duration (ΔAPD90, +51 ± 17 ms vs. 4 ± 6 ms, P >.01), (2) effective refractory period (ΔERP, +84 ± 23 ms vs. 18 ± 9 ms, P <.001), (3) diastolic threshold of excitation (ΔDTE, +0.32 ± 0.11 mA vs. 0.03 ± 0.02 mA, P <.001), and (4) Vmax (ΔVmax, −43 ± 14% vs. −11 ± 4%, P <.01, n = 5 to 6; all recorded at 10 μM, cycle length = 500 ms). Persistent AF was induced in 10 of 10 atria exposed to ACh alone; subsequent addition of dronedarone or amiodarone terminated AF in 1 of 7 and 4 of 5 atria, respectively. Persistent ACh-mediated AF was induced in 5 of 6 and 0 of 5 atria pretreated with dronedarone and amiodarone, respectively.ConclusionThe electrophysiological effects and anti-AF efficacy of acute dronedarone are much weaker than those of amiodarone in a canine model of AF. The efficacy of acute dronedarone to prevent induction of acetylcholine-mediated AF as well as to terminate persistent AF in canine right atria is relatively poor. Our data suggest that acute dronedarone is a poor substitute for amiodarone for acute cardioversion of AF or prevention of AF recurrence.
